Kensworth Alton FRANCIS, 31, of the City of Mississauga has been convicted and sentenced to life in custody following a 2022 double homicide in the City of Vaughan.

On Saturday, July 23, 2022, at approximately 3:30 a.m., officers responded to the ATL Lounge located at 2220 Highway 7 West. When officers arrived on scene, they located three victims suffering from gunshot wounds.

Two of the victims succumbed to their injuries. They were identified as 25-year-old Tosin AMOS-AROWOSHEGBE and 22-year-old Chibueze MOMAH. A third victim, a 20-year-old woman, survived her injuries.

Members of the York Regional Police Homicide Unit partnered with the BOLO (Be On the Look Out) Program, the RCMP INTERPOL Fugitive Apprehension Support Team and the United States Marshals Service in an effort to locate the suspect, who was wanted on a Canada-wide warrant.

On Tuesday, March 26, 2024, the suspect was arrested by the United States Marshals Service in Hartford, Connecticut. Investigators worked with the Ministry of the Attorney General to extradite the suspect to York Region.

Kensworth Alton FRANCIS was charged with two counts of First-Degree Murder and one count of Attempted Murder.

Following a jury trial, FRANCIS was found guilty of two counts of First-Degree Murder and one count of Unlawfully Causing Bodily Harm.

On Friday, June 19, 2026, FRANCIS was sentenced at the Ontario Court of Justice in Newmarket, to two life sentences for First-Degree Murder, with no eligibility for parole for 25 years. FRANCIS was also sentenced to eight years imprisonment for Unlawfully Causing Bodily Harm. All sentences are to be served concurrently.
